Abuja (Sundiata Post) – Plateau State Governor, Caleb Mutfwang has felicitated with the Muslim Faithful in Plateau State and across Nigeria as they celebrate EID-EL-FITR
In a statement signed by his Director of Press and Public Affairs, Dr. Gyang Bere, the Governor encouraged the Muslim Ummah to seize the occasion to offer prayers for the unity, peace, and progress of Plateau State.
Mutfwang commended the resilience, devotion, and discipline exhibited by the Muslim community throughout the Ramadan period.
He called on the Muslims to follow the teachings and values of Prophet Muhammed, emphasizing love, tolerance, and peaceful coexistence.
He enjoined them to emulate the timeless lessons from the Holy Prophet’s life, which include perseverance, devotion, sacrifice, tolerance, charity, selflessness, and humility in their daily lives for the benefit of society.
“Ramadan is a time when hearts are softened, generosity overflows, and acts of kindness illuminate the path of the less privileged in our society. It reminds us that true wealth is not in material possessions but in the compassion and love we extend to one another,” the Governor said.
He further emphasized the importance of seeking divine guidance for leaders, urging Muslims to remain steadfast in their prayers for wisdom, justice, and good governance across all levels of leadership in Nigeria.
“As this sacred month draws to a close, I extend my warmest greetings and best wishes to you all on behalf of the government and the peace-loving people of Plateau State. This season of sacrifice and self-denial has imparted invaluable lessons, shaping our character and reinforcing our faith. I encourage you to sustain the spirit of prayer and intercession for continued peace and prosperity in our dear state and country,” Mutfwang added.
Expressing gratitude to the people for their firm support, he reaffirmed his administration’s commitment to their welfare, pledging to address governance challenges, enhance security, and mitigate economic hardships with renewed vigor and determination.
“I am particularly pleased that Plateau State is fast reclaiming its reputation as a symbol of peace and a prime destination for tourism. The time has come, and the time is now, for us to unite in purpose, speak with one voice, and embark on a progressive journey toward the Plateau of our dreams.”
The Governor reiterated his dedication to an all-inclusive government, ensuring that all citizens, regardless of their tribe or religious affiliations, actively participate in the development of the Plateau project.
